class TestServerRequest:
    @pytest.fixture(scope="class")
    def corenlp_client(self):
        """ Client to run tests on """
        client = corenlp.CoreNLPClient(annotators='tokenize,ssplit,pos', server_id='stanza_request_tests_server')
        yield client
        client.stop()


    def test_basic(self, corenlp_client):
        """ Basic test of making a request, test default output format is a Document """
        ann = corenlp_client.annotate(EN_DOC, output_format="text")
        compare_ignoring_whitespace(ann, EN_DOC_GOLD)
        ann = corenlp_client.annotate(EN_DOC)
        assert isinstance(ann, Document)


    def test_python_dict(self, corenlp_client):
        """ Test using a Python dictionary to specify all request properties """
        ann = corenlp_client.annotate(ES_DOC, properties=ES_PROPS, output_format="text")
        compare_ignoring_whitespace(ann, ES_PROPS_GOLD)
        ann = corenlp_client.annotate(FRENCH_DOC, properties=FRENCH_CUSTOM_PROPS)
        compare_ignoring_whitespace(ann, FRENCH_CUSTOM_GOLD)


    def test_lang_setting(self, corenlp_client):
        """ Test using a Stanford CoreNLP supported languages as a properties key """
        ann = corenlp_client.annotate(GERMAN_DOC, properties="german", output_format="text")
        compare_ignoring_whitespace(ann, GERMAN_DOC_GOLD)


    def test_annotators_and_output_format(self, corenlp_client):
        """ Test setting the annotators and output_format """
        ann = corenlp_client.annotate(FRENCH_DOC, properties=FRENCH_EXTRA_PROPS,
                                      annotators="tokenize,ssplit,mwt,pos", output_format="json")
        assert ann == FRENCH_JSON_GOLD
